CHapter 3: beyond the WallWhile working to unite the free folk under his banner, Mance sentTormund Giantbane to the ancient barrows of the First Men lookingfor the Horn of Winter, the ancient artifact Joramun blew to wake thegiants from the earth long ago. It is believed that the Horn also hasthe power to destroy the Wall, allowing the free folk to freely pass intothe lands to the South. Tormund was able to find the horn and bringit to Mance, but even with the horn in his possession Mance is loatheto use it.Mance knows the Wall is more than a physical obstacle; built byBran the Builder long ago it is a thing of magic in addition to beingof stone and ice. The Wall does not just block travel but stops the supernaturalcreatures of the Land of Always Winter from crossing intothe realms of Westeros to the south, forming the last line of defenseagainst the Others and their ilk. While Mance’s primary goal is to movehis people to the south, away from the encroaching Others, he wouldrather do so without destroying the Wall, so his people may find shelterbehind it as well. His hope is that the free folk can take the Gift as theirown, knowing from his own trips over the Wall that it has seen littleuse in recent decades. Having no interest in bowing to the lords of theSouth, Mance Rayder knows his people will not change their ways, andthus gaining the agreement of the Southern kingdoms to this arrangementwill be difficult to get at best. He hopes the threat of destroyingthe Wall will be enough to sway them. While Mance Rayder wouldrather have the Wall protecting him from the Others than destroy it,better to give his people a few more years away from the cold of theOthers than see them slain.Mance RayderThe current King-beyond-the-Wall, Mance Rayder is inarguably themost powerful mortal north of the Wall. Commanding a vast horde offollowers, he is set on saving his people by moving them south of theWall, hopefully without destroying the Wall in the process. If he succeedshe will change the free folk forever.HistoryMance Rayder was born among the free folk, adopted as a babe by theNight’s <strong>Watch</strong>. Mance grew up among the Night’s <strong>Watch</strong>, serving loyallyfor most of his life, doing well due to his natural cunning and skillboth in war and leadership. It was these skills that often earned him aplace among the rangings north of the Wall, and it was on such a missionthat his place in the Night’s <strong>Watch</strong> was lost.While ranging north of the Wall, Mance and his patrol were huntingan elk when they were attacked by a shadowcat drawn by the smellof the elk’s blood. Mance was badly wounded in the ensuing fight andwas taken to a nearby village of the free folk for treatment since hisbrothers did not think he would survive the trip back to the Wall. Thefree folk woman who cared for him also patched his rent and tornblack cloak using red silk taken from a wrecked ship from the FrozenShore, her greatest treasure. When Mance returned to the Wall, hewas ordered to give up this cloak that the woman had given so muchto mend for an undamaged black cloak, and this was not a choiceMance was willing to make. He left the Night’s <strong>Watch</strong> next morningfor the lands of the free folk.Mance quickly found a place among the free folk where his charismaand gift for song and tale telling made him popular among thesouthern tribes. His readiness to fight against the Night’s <strong>Watch</strong> allowedhim to quickly make his allegiances clear. Rangings becamemuch more dangerous for the Night’s <strong>Watch</strong> with Mance Rayderworking against them. While Mance helped the free folk against theirfoes to the south he could do little to help them against the ancientevils awakening to the north.
